    Does anyone think another country or a domestic company will start producing 7.62x54r steel case ammo once all the Russian stock dries up? I have been tempted at getting a few rifles in this caliber but concerned I will end up with another curio and relic that is hard to get cheap ammo for like 303 British is now.

    Czech and Serbian surplus is still around and I thought S&B was still cranking it out. Otherwise, there is still a lot of Russian stockpiles in countries we are friendly with. People assume that if it’s Russian it’s outlawed here. That’s not the case at all.
